com.mirth.connect.plugins.datapruner.DataPrunerException: java.text.ParseException: Format.parseObject(String) failed

Mirth Project | Eduardo Armendariz | 2 years ago
tip
Your exception is missing from the Samebug knowledge base.
Here are the best solutions we found on the Internet.
Click on the to mark the helpful solution and get rewards for you help.
  1. 0

    If you input an invalid time(02:59PM) on the pruner settings the client will allow you to save the page but the following will be thrown in the server log: {code} ERROR 2014-11-06 14:59:52,235 [qtp246079278-35] com.mirth.connect.plugins.datapruner.DataPrunerService: Failed to reschedule the data pruner. com.mirth.connect.plugins.datapruner.DataPrunerException: java.text.ParseException: Format.parseObject(String) failed at com.mirth.connect.plugins.datapruner.DefaultDataPrunerController.update(DefaultDataPrunerController.java:95) at com.mirth.connect.plugins.datapruner.DataPrunerService.update(DataPrunerService.java:66) at com.mirth.connect.server.controllers.DefaultExtensionController.updatePluginProperties(DefaultExtensionController.java:371) at com.mirth.connect.server.servlets.ExtensionServlet.doPost(ExtensionServlet.java:99) at javax.servlet.http.HttpServlet.service(HttpServlet.java:727) at javax.servlet.http.HttpServlet.service(HttpServlet.java:820) at org.eclipse.jetty.servlet.ServletHolder.handle(ServletHolder.java:652) at org.eclipse.jetty.servlet.ServletHandler.doHandle(ServletHandler.java:447) at org.eclipse.jetty.server.session.SessionHandler.doHandle(SessionHandler.java:225) at org.eclipse.jetty.server.handler.ContextHandler.doHandle(ContextHandler.java:1038) at org.eclipse.jetty.servlet.ServletHandler.doScope(ServletHandler.java:374) at org.eclipse.jetty.server.session.SessionHandler.doScope(SessionHandler.java:189) at org.eclipse.jetty.server.handler.ContextHandler.doScope(ContextHandler.java:972) at org.eclipse.jetty.server.handler.ScopedHandler.handle(ScopedHandler.java:135) at org.eclipse.jetty.server.handler.HandlerList.handle(HandlerList.java:52) at org.eclipse.jetty.server.handler.HandlerWrapper.handle(HandlerWrapper.java:116) at org.eclipse.jetty.server.Server.handle(Server.java:363) at org.eclipse.jetty.server.AbstractHttpConnection.handleRequest(AbstractHttpConnection.java:483) at org.eclipse.jetty.server.AbstractHttpConnection.content(AbstractHttpConnection.java:931) at org.eclipse.jetty.server.AbstractHttpConnection$RequestHandler.content(AbstractHttpConnection.java:992) at org.eclipse.jetty.http.HttpParser.parseNext(HttpParser.java:856) at org.eclipse.jetty.http.HttpParser.parseAvailable(HttpParser.java:240) at org.eclipse.jetty.server.AsyncHttpConnection.handle(AsyncHttpConnection.java:82) at org.eclipse.jetty.io.nio.SslConnection.handle(SslConnection.java:196) at org.eclipse.jetty.io.nio.SelectChannelEndPoint.handle(SelectChannelEndPoint.java:627) at org.eclipse.jetty.io.nio.SelectChannelEndPoint$1.run(SelectChannelEndPoint.java:51) at org.eclipse.jetty.util.thread.QueuedThreadPool.runJob(QueuedThreadPool.java:608) at org.eclipse.jetty.util.thread.QueuedThreadPool$3.run(QueuedThreadPool.java:543) at java.lang.Thread.run(Thread.java:745) Caused by: java.text.ParseException: Format.parseObject(String) failed at java.text.Format.parseObject(Format.java:245) at javax.swing.text.InternationalFormatter.stringToValue(InternationalFormatter.java:402) at javax.swing.text.InternationalFormatter.stringToValue(InternationalFormatter.java:320) at com.mirth.connect.plugins.datapruner.DefaultDataPrunerController.createTrigger(DefaultDataPrunerController.java:294) at com.mirth.connect.plugins.datapruner.DefaultDataPrunerController.update(DefaultDataPrunerController.java:88) ... 28 more {code} Your input is reverted but there should be some sort of client error thrown. This also kind of applies to the other fields where the day of the week can be saved as something invalid. Maybe this should just be some sort of drop down anyways.

    Mirth Project | 2 years ago | Eduardo Armendariz
    com.mirth.connect.plugins.datapruner.DataPrunerException: java.text.ParseException: Format.parseObject(String) failed
  2. 0

    If you input an invalid time(02:59PM) on the pruner settings the client will allow you to save the page but the following will be thrown in the server log: {code} ERROR 2014-11-06 14:59:52,235 [qtp246079278-35] com.mirth.connect.plugins.datapruner.DataPrunerService: Failed to reschedule the data pruner. com.mirth.connect.plugins.datapruner.DataPrunerException: java.text.ParseException: Format.parseObject(String) failed at com.mirth.connect.plugins.datapruner.DefaultDataPrunerController.update(DefaultDataPrunerController.java:95) at com.mirth.connect.plugins.datapruner.DataPrunerService.update(DataPrunerService.java:66) at com.mirth.connect.server.controllers.DefaultExtensionController.updatePluginProperties(DefaultExtensionController.java:371) at com.mirth.connect.server.servlets.ExtensionServlet.doPost(ExtensionServlet.java:99) at javax.servlet.http.HttpServlet.service(HttpServlet.java:727) at javax.servlet.http.HttpServlet.service(HttpServlet.java:820) at org.eclipse.jetty.servlet.ServletHolder.handle(ServletHolder.java:652) at org.eclipse.jetty.servlet.ServletHandler.doHandle(ServletHandler.java:447) at org.eclipse.jetty.server.session.SessionHandler.doHandle(SessionHandler.java:225) at org.eclipse.jetty.server.handler.ContextHandler.doHandle(ContextHandler.java:1038) at org.eclipse.jetty.servlet.ServletHandler.doScope(ServletHandler.java:374) at org.eclipse.jetty.server.session.SessionHandler.doScope(SessionHandler.java:189) at org.eclipse.jetty.server.handler.ContextHandler.doScope(ContextHandler.java:972) at org.eclipse.jetty.server.handler.ScopedHandler.handle(ScopedHandler.java:135) at org.eclipse.jetty.server.handler.HandlerList.handle(HandlerList.java:52) at org.eclipse.jetty.server.handler.HandlerWrapper.handle(HandlerWrapper.java:116) at org.eclipse.jetty.server.Server.handle(Server.java:363) at org.eclipse.jetty.server.AbstractHttpConnection.handleRequest(AbstractHttpConnection.java:483) at org.eclipse.jetty.server.AbstractHttpConnection.content(AbstractHttpConnection.java:931) at org.eclipse.jetty.server.AbstractHttpConnection$RequestHandler.content(AbstractHttpConnection.java:992) at org.eclipse.jetty.http.HttpParser.parseNext(HttpParser.java:856) at org.eclipse.jetty.http.HttpParser.parseAvailable(HttpParser.java:240) at org.eclipse.jetty.server.AsyncHttpConnection.handle(AsyncHttpConnection.java:82) at org.eclipse.jetty.io.nio.SslConnection.handle(SslConnection.java:196) at org.eclipse.jetty.io.nio.SelectChannelEndPoint.handle(SelectChannelEndPoint.java:627) at org.eclipse.jetty.io.nio.SelectChannelEndPoint$1.run(SelectChannelEndPoint.java:51) at org.eclipse.jetty.util.thread.QueuedThreadPool.runJob(QueuedThreadPool.java:608) at org.eclipse.jetty.util.thread.QueuedThreadPool$3.run(QueuedThreadPool.java:543) at java.lang.Thread.run(Thread.java:745) Caused by: java.text.ParseException: Format.parseObject(String) failed at java.text.Format.parseObject(Format.java:245) at javax.swing.text.InternationalFormatter.stringToValue(InternationalFormatter.java:402) at javax.swing.text.InternationalFormatter.stringToValue(InternationalFormatter.java:320) at com.mirth.connect.plugins.datapruner.DefaultDataPrunerController.createTrigger(DefaultDataPrunerController.java:294) at com.mirth.connect.plugins.datapruner.DefaultDataPrunerController.update(DefaultDataPrunerController.java:88) ... 28 more {code} Your input is reverted but there should be some sort of client error thrown. This also kind of applies to the other fields where the day of the week can be saved as something invalid. Maybe this should just be some sort of drop down anyways.

    Mirth Project | 2 years ago | Eduardo Armendariz
    com.mirth.connect.plugins.datapruner.DataPrunerException: java.text.ParseException: Format.parseObject(String) failed
  3. 0

    Trouble Running Java Applet on the web page (Images+Code Inside) - HELP

    javaprogrammingforums.com | 1 year ago
    java.text.ParseException: Unparseable date: "ד' ינו 14 21:30:36 IST 2015" ****at java.text.DateFormat.parse(DateFormat.java:357)
  4. Speed up your debug routine!

    Automated exception search integrated into your IDE

  5. 0

    Trouble Running Java Applet on the web page (Images+Code Inside) - HELP

    javaprogrammingforums.com | 1 year ago
    java.text.ParseException: Unparseable date: "ד' ינו 14 21:30:36 IST 2015" ****at java.text.DateFormat.parse(DateFormat.java:357)

    Root Cause Analysis

    1. java.text.ParseException

      Format.parseObject(String) failed

      at java.text.Format.parseObject()
    2. Java RT
      InternationalFormatter.stringToValue
      1. java.text.Format.parseObject(Format.java:245)
      2. javax.swing.text.InternationalFormatter.stringToValue(InternationalFormatter.java:402)
      3. javax.swing.text.InternationalFormatter.stringToValue(InternationalFormatter.java:320)
      3 frames
    3. com.mirth.connect
      ExtensionServlet.doPost
      1. com.mirth.connect.plugins.datapruner.DefaultDataPrunerController.createTrigger(DefaultDataPrunerController.java:294)
      2. com.mirth.connect.plugins.datapruner.DefaultDataPrunerController.update(DefaultDataPrunerController.java:88)
      3. com.mirth.connect.plugins.datapruner.DataPrunerService.update(DataPrunerService.java:66)
      4. com.mirth.connect.server.controllers.DefaultExtensionController.updatePluginProperties(DefaultExtensionController.java:371)
      5. com.mirth.connect.server.servlets.ExtensionServlet.doPost(ExtensionServlet.java:99)
      5 frames
    4. JavaServlet
      HttpServlet.service
      1. javax.servlet.http.HttpServlet.service(HttpServlet.java:727)
      2. javax.servlet.http.HttpServlet.service(HttpServlet.java:820)
      2 frames
    5. Jetty
      AsyncHttpConnection.handle
      1. org.eclipse.jetty.servlet.ServletHolder.handle(ServletHolder.java:652)
      2. org.eclipse.jetty.servlet.ServletHandler.doHandle(ServletHandler.java:447)
      3. org.eclipse.jetty.server.session.SessionHandler.doHandle(SessionHandler.java:225)
      4. org.eclipse.jetty.server.handler.ContextHandler.doHandle(ContextHandler.java:1038)
      5. org.eclipse.jetty.servlet.ServletHandler.doScope(ServletHandler.java:374)
      6. org.eclipse.jetty.server.session.SessionHandler.doScope(SessionHandler.java:189)
      7. org.eclipse.jetty.server.handler.ContextHandler.doScope(ContextHandler.java:972)
      8. org.eclipse.jetty.server.handler.ScopedHandler.handle(ScopedHandler.java:135)
      9. org.eclipse.jetty.server.handler.HandlerList.handle(HandlerList.java:52)
      10. org.eclipse.jetty.server.handler.HandlerWrapper.handle(HandlerWrapper.java:116)
      11. org.eclipse.jetty.server.Server.handle(Server.java:363)
      12. org.eclipse.jetty.server.AbstractHttpConnection.handleRequest(AbstractHttpConnection.java:483)
      13. org.eclipse.jetty.server.AbstractHttpConnection.content(AbstractHttpConnection.java:931)
      14. org.eclipse.jetty.server.AbstractHttpConnection$RequestHandler.content(AbstractHttpConnection.java:992)
      15. org.eclipse.jetty.http.HttpParser.parseNext(HttpParser.java:856)
      16. org.eclipse.jetty.http.HttpParser.parseAvailable(HttpParser.java:240)
      17. org.eclipse.jetty.server.AsyncHttpConnection.handle(AsyncHttpConnection.java:82)
      17 frames
    6. GWT dev
      SelectChannelEndPoint$1.run
      1. org.eclipse.jetty.io.nio.SslConnection.handle(SslConnection.java:196)
      2. org.eclipse.jetty.io.nio.SelectChannelEndPoint.handle(SelectChannelEndPoint.java:627)
      3. org.eclipse.jetty.io.nio.SelectChannelEndPoint$1.run(SelectChannelEndPoint.java:51)
      3 frames
    7. Jetty
      QueuedThreadPool$3.run
      1. org.eclipse.jetty.util.thread.QueuedThreadPool.runJob(QueuedThreadPool.java:608)
      2. org.eclipse.jetty.util.thread.QueuedThreadPool$3.run(QueuedThreadPool.java:543)
      2 frames
    8. Java RT
      Thread.run
      1. java.lang.Thread.run(Thread.java:745)
      1 frame